Transaction 94ffedb79e6c5799b65a72f3092b99a3face84afea10081622932e6df1830222
1 Input
1 Output
-
94ffedb79e6c5799b65a72f3092b99a3face84afea10081622932e6df1830222:0
- value
- 522903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2f40d47fd52b038fc559c839363caef086556b8 OP_EQUAL
- address
- 3LvSBrFj5tZm2AjT7LwWdtvSHtL5KWjvrR